Q. What products need FDA-compliant labeling?

All food, beverage, dietary supplement, cosmetic, and OTC drug products require FDA-compliant labels before being sold in the U.S.

Q. What are the mandatory label elements for FDA compliance?

Labels must include:

  • Product name (Statement of Identity)
  • Net quantity of contents (weight or volume)
  • Ingredient list in descending order
  • Nutrition Facts or Supplement Facts panel
  • Allergen declarations (if applicable)
  • Manufacturer or distributor name and address

Q. Can I make health or nutrient claims on my product label?

Yes, but all health-related claims must meet FDA guidelines. Claims such as:

  • “Supports immune health” (structure-function claim)
  • “Low in cholesterol” (nutrient content claim)
  • “Reduces risk of heart disease” (health claim)

Must be scientifically substantiated and formatted within FDA rules to avoid misbranding violations.

Q. What happens if my labels do not comply with FDA regulations?

  • The FDA can detain or refuse entry of your products at U.S. ports.
  • You may face fines, recalls, or legal penalties for misbranded products.
  • Non-compliant labels may result in increased FDA scrutiny for future shipments.
